Overview Information Components Participating Organizations National Institute Neurological Disorders Stroke NINDS) National Institute Mental Health NIMH) Section Funding Opportunity Description Areas scientific interest the NIMH reflect Neuroscience areas priority detailed the NIMH Strategic Plan found within following divisions offices. Division Neuroscience Basic Behavioral Science DNBBS) supports research programs basic neuroscience, genetics, resource technology development, drug discovery. Examples priorities include are limited these topics: Discover novel mechanisms nervous system development across genes, proteins, cells circuitry) signaling properties underlie emergence cognition, emotion, social behavior. Develop use innovative strategies, including genome-wide comparative approaches, discover genes gene regulatory mechanisms underlying brain functions includingcognition, emotion, social behavior. Discover cellular molecular mechanisms whereby hormones immune molecules modulate signaling brain circuits relevant emotion regulation, cognition, social behavior. Develop empirically evaluate computational theoretical models address plasticity brain circuits during development impacting cognitive, affective, social behaviors. Research elucidate genomic risk factors underlie mental disorders. Division Translational Research DTR) supports research translates knowledge basic science discover etiology, pathophysiology, trajectory mental disorders develops effective interventions children adults. Examples priorities include are limited these topics: Delineate specific neural circuits contributing one more major mental disorders subtypes mental disorders. Identify mechanisms e.g., biological, behavioral, environmental) confer vulnerability psychiatric illnesses. Discover novel targets future therapeutic intervention identifying causal relationships between neural circuits symptom expression. Delineate neurobehavioral mechanisms responsible the development psychopathology, including critical sensitive periods brain development the effects sex, behavior, experience the brain. Assess mechanisms action efficacious interventions the brain bench, pre-clinical context, computational models. Division AIDS Research DAR) supports research basic clinical neuroscience HIV infection. Examples priorities include are limited these topics: Understand decipher a molecular level, HIV associated neuroimmune dysregulation impacts neuronal receptors, neuroendocrine milieu, neurotransmitters synaptic plasticity the context HIV anti-retroviral therapy. Pre-clinical research studies target neuroimmune dysregulation, blood brain barrier disruption altered neuronal circuitry individuals living HIV to decipher potential CNS toxicities associated anti-retroviral therapy other emergent treatments HIV cure. Support use state-of-the-art epi)genetic approaches identify validate viral host genetic factors influence pathophysiology manifestations HIV-induced CNS dysfunction. Define characterize HIV persistence the CNS the context suppressive highly active antiretroviral therapy foster translational research enable eradication HIV the brain. Office Technology Development Coordination OTDC): Supports basic applied research related the development scientific tools, technologies, approaches related brain behavioral research. Any Clinical Trial research submitted NIMH under R21 mechanism must follow guidance noted NIMH NOT-MH-19-006. is, NIMH supports hypothesis-driven mechanistic clinical trial studies basic and/or translational discovery research health human subjects in pathobiology, pathophysiology psychopathology mental disorders in HIV infection the central nervous system CNS). goal to address basic questions to interrogate concept biology, behavior, pathophysiology will provide insight to understanding mental health mental disorders. https://www.nimh.nih.gov/funding/opportunities-announcements/clinical-t…. Notice to Extend Eligibility for Submission of Diversity K22 Applications due to COVIDrelated Disruptions
Expiration Date: Sábado, Enero 1, 2028
NOFO Number: NOT-NS-20-076
Viernes, Junio 26, 2020
Notice Type: NOT
Notice Extend Eligibility Submission Diversity K22 Applications due COVID–related Disruptions Notice Number: NOT-NS-20-076 Key Dates Release Date: June 26, 2020 Related Announcements PAR-18-469 - NINDS Advanced Postdoctoral Career Transition Award Promote Diversity Neuroscience Research K22-No Independent Clinical Trials) PAR-18-468 - NINDS Advanced Postdoctoral Career Transition Award Promote Diversity Neuroscience Research K22-Clinical Trial Required) Issued National Institute Neurological Disorders Stroke NINDS) Purpose Under normal circumstances, individuals must no than 5 years cumulative postdoctoral research experience i.e. research experience subsequent completion the doctorate) the relevant due date be eligible apply the NINDS K22 Advanced Postdoctoral Career Transition Award Promote Diversity Neuroscience Research. NINDS understands COVID-19 caused major disruption the ability many individuals make progress their research. Though subject future updates, NINDS will provide least 2-receipt cycle extension roughly 8 additional months) eligibility individuals whose eligibility apply the K22, under normal eligibility rules including resubmission policy defined NOT-OD-18-197), expiring between June/July 2020 February/March 2021 inclusive these dates). addition, those normally have eligible apply the June/July 2021 receipt date have 1-receipt cycle roughly 4 months) extension. Example 1: Under normal eligibility rules, final due date which individual apply the K22 June/July 12, 2020. individual now eligible apply the K22 June/July, 2020, October/November 2020 February/March 2021. Example 2: Under normal eligibility rules, final due date which individual apply the K99/R00 February/March 12, 2021. individual now eligible apply the K22 through October/November, 2021 due dates. Example 3: Under normal eligibility rules, final due date which individual apply the K22 June/July 12, 2021. individual now eligible apply the K22 through October/November, 2021 due dates. Example 4: Under normal eligibility rules, final due date which individual apply the K22 February/March 12, 2020. individual no longer eligible the K22. Example 5: individual applied the K22 the February/March, 2020 due date and, under normal eligibility rules, still within eligibility window the June/July, 2020 due date; however, summary statement this individual released after June/July due date. Because review this applicant’s initial submission not completed time the applicant resubmit the June/July 2020 due date, individual does receive extension eligibility is longer eligible apply the K22.
